Healdsburg Art Festival

The Healdsburg Center for the Arts, in partnership with the City of Healdsburg is now issuing a call to artists for the 2020 Healdsburg Arts Festival!

 

This juried art and fine craft show takes place on the beloved Healdsburg Plaza. The Art Festival is limited to 56 artists and will include art demonstrations, interactive art experiences, live performances, food and wine.

 

All forms of visual and fine craft art are welcome to apply.

 

Location

The Festival is held on the historic plaza of downtown Healdsburg in the heart of Sonoma Wine Country. Just an hour north of San Francisco. Healdsburg is a vibrant community and draws visitors from across the US.

Call for artists: Expanded Drawing

The Concept

AIR Gallery, Altrincham, invites establishing and emerging artists of all disciplines to consider and submit artworks centered around what drawing is today. 

Drawing has always been used as a tool to slow down and observe. Challenging the pre-conceptions of a drawing in contemporary art. Everything has to begin somewhere and even with a mark, can drawing expand out both physically between and across mediums? Is drawing more than just marks on a page? Is the act/action of drawing just as important? How can we expand the notions of drawing through painting, sculpture, performance and social contexts?

Suffra-Jetting

Suffra-Jetting: March 13 - April 4, 2020

It’s been 100 years since women were given the right to vote in the United States. In this exhibition, WMG is soliciting work by female identified artists that represent the experience of being a woman and the nuanced (and overt) ways that being female supports or subverts your daily life.  Artwork should reflect your narrative experience – your story of being female.  We’re searching for a variety of voices to share triumphs and setbacks that highlight gains made or what is missing in our society in terms of equality between the sexes. What is your story and how is it woven into a struggle for equality over 100 years old that has only definitively delivered the right to vote? 

Prisma Art Prize

The cultural association Il Varco is glad to announce its 3rd PRISMA Art Prize, an exhibition entirely organized by artists for the artists. A painting competition with $2000+ in Cash Awards and many other prizes, which takes place seasonally and yearly in Rome. Bringing together the spirit of community and collaboration and the efforts of many young artists involved, it is meant to create a place for art and artists to grow and share their work in a friendly and competitive environments with no favoritism.
